Studying Online at Arkansas State University-Newport
Online coursework is an option at Arkansas State University-Newport. Of 1,868 students, 764 (41%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 314 (17%) took at least some classes online.

Earnings for Allied Health Professions Graduates from Arkansas State University-Newport
Graduates of Arkansas State University-Newport’s Allied Health Professions program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 2 years | $32,162 |
| 3 years | $32,198 |
| 4 years | $37,521 |
| 5 years | $41,519 |
How do these earnings stack up against the rest of the school? Four years out, Allied Health Professions graduates from Arkansas State University-Newport earn a median of $37,521, compared with $43,737 for all Arkansas State University-Newport graduates — about 14% lower than the school-wide median.
Median Debt at Graduation
The median debt for Allied Health Professions graduates from Arkansas State University-Newport stands at $9,000.
